Transaction 51766331d4e650e6cb37b51d28fa270974ed660143c3d09cf333ccc0ea2d1e51

2 Input
2 Outputs
  • 51766331d4e650e6cb37b51d28fa270974ed660143c3d09cf333ccc0ea2d1e51:0
  • value  226064
    address  bc1qtzf5yhyk2k7xqqewx6ssuyue6xz7ew4jg88e5s
  • 51766331d4e650e6cb37b51d28fa270974ed660143c3d09cf333ccc0ea2d1e51:1
  • value  1527188
    address  1NHan6KRTqLjmdamZNESJi1wRMJYPEoS4C